DC's 2022 celebration of pride unfolds with a vibrant anthology that showcases a rich tapestry of stories and characters. This collection dives deep into the lives and struggles of LGBTQ+ heroes and allies, all woven together by an impressive lineup of talented writers and artists. Each contribution illustrates the importance of representation and the diverse experiences within the community, offering readers a chance to connect with a wide array of perspectives.
The artwork dances off the page, blending dynamic illustrations with heartfelt narratives that capture both joy and resilience. From established heroes to newcomers, the characters resonate with authenticity as they navigate their identities and relationships in a world that is often challenging. Readers are invited to witness their journeys, highlighting acceptance, love, and the strength found in community.
Beyond the tales of individual struggles, this anthology embodies a collective celebration of pride itself—an invitation for all to embrace their true selves. As each story unfolds, the spirit of camaraderie and inclusivity prevails, making this a crucial read for anyone seeking to understand the significance of pride in the ever-evolving landscape of heroes and their stories.
